Output 3d57312c19ea92c7284ac87cf3613df7dc7020deb19c92739970e1b98fb03ec2:2

value
2891176
script pubkey
OP_0 OP_PUSHBYTES_20 b0c862f50f44df77fa8f2ab337995377d40a29dd
address
bc1qkryx9ag0gn0h075092en0x2nwl2q52wakd5409
transaction
3d57312c19ea92c7284ac87cf3613df7dc7020deb19c92739970e1b98fb03ec2